Desalination Magic: How Reverse Osmosis Works
Reverse osmosis is a powerful technique that can transform salty seawater into clean, drinkable freshwater. This remarkable discovery works by forcing seawater through a special membrane. The membrane acts as a barrier, allowing only water molecules to pass through while blocking larger salt and mineral molecules.
The result is fresh water on one side of the membrane and highly concentrated brine on the other. Marine Watermaker Maintenance: Keeping Your System Pristine
Regular upkeep of your marine watermaker is essential for ensuring optimal performance and a long lifespan. Neglecting routine checkups can lead to problems, compromising the quality of your drinking water and potentially damaging the system entirely. A well-maintained watermaker supplies clean, safe water, a vital resource for sailors and boaters.
To keep your watermaker in tip-top shape, observe these essential maintenance practices:
* Completely rinse the pre-filter on a regular basis.
* Inspect the membranes for signs of damage or fouling.
* Swap the filters according to the manufacturer's guidelines.
* Desalinate the system regularly with fresh water.
Monitor the water pressure and output flow rate, as these can indicate potential malfunctions. By being proactive with your maintenance schedule, you can prevent costly repairs and provide a constant supply of clean drinking water for your next adventure.
